Android app z wykorzystaniem HTML, CSS i JavaScript to aplikacja mobilna, która została stworzona przy użyciu popularnych języków webowych. Dzięki temu połączeniu możliwe jest tworzenie interaktywnych i responsywnych aplikacji na urządzenia z systemem Android. Wykorzystanie tych języków pozwala na szybkie i efektywne tworzenie aplikacji, a także umożliwia łatwe dostosowanie jej do różnych rozmiarów ekranów. Aplikacje te są coraz bardziej popularne ze względu na swoją prostotę i uniwersalność, co sprawia, że są one idealnym wyborem dla wielu programistów i użytkowników.
Jak stworzyć responsywną aplikację mobilną z wykorzystaniem HTML, CSS i JavaScript na platformie Android?
Aby stworzyć responsywną aplikację mobilną na platformie Android, należy wykorzystać języki HTML, CSS i JavaScript. W pierwszej kolejności należy zaprojektować interfejs użytkownika, uwzględniając różne rozmiary ekranów urządzeń mobilnych. Następnie należy użyć odpowiednich technik w HTML i CSS, takich jak media queries, aby dostosować wygląd aplikacji do różnych rozdzielczości ekranów.
W celu zapewnienia płynnego działania aplikacji na urządzeniach mobilnych, należy również zoptymalizować kod JavaScript. Można to zrobić poprzez minimalizację i kompresję plików oraz unikanie złożonych operacji.
Ważnym elementem jest również testowanie aplikacji na różnych urządzeniach mobilnych, aby upewnić się, że działa ona poprawnie na każdym z nich. Można to zrobić za pomocą emulatorów lub fizycznych urządzeń.
Podsumowując, aby stworzyć responsywną aplikację mobilną na platformie Android, należy odpowiednio zaprojektować interfejs użytkownika oraz zoptymalizować kod HTML, CSS i JavaScript. Należy również przetestować aplikację na różnych urządzeniach mobilnych.
Najważniejsze narzędzia i biblioteki do tworzenia aplikacji mobilnych z wykorzystaniem HTML, CSS i JavaScript na system Android
Aplikacje mobilne na system Android mogą być tworzone przy użyciu narzędzi i bibliotek, które wykorzystują HTML, CSS i JavaScript. Są to między innymi:
1. Apache Cordova – platforma umożliwiająca tworzenie aplikacji hybrydowych, czyli połączenie kodu HTML, CSS i JavaScript z natywnym kodem Androida.
2. React Native – framework stworzony przez Facebooka, który pozwala na pisanie aplikacji mobilnych w języku JavaScript z wykorzystaniem komponentów natywnych.
3. Ionic – framework oparty na AngularJS, który umożliwia tworzenie aplikacji hybrydowych z wykorzystaniem HTML, CSS i JavaScript.
4. jQuery Mobile – biblioteka pozwalająca na tworzenie responsywnych interfejsów użytkownika dla aplikacji mobilnych.
5. Bootstrap – popularny framework do tworzenia responsywnych stron internetowych, który może być również wykorzystany do projektowania interfejsów dla aplikacji mobilnych.
6. Materialize – biblioteka oparta na Material Design od Google, która umożliwia tworzenie nowoczesnych i intuicyjnych interfejsów dla aplikacji mobilnych.
Wybór konkretnego narzędzia lub biblioteki zależy od preferencji programisty oraz wymagań projektu. Warto jednak pamiętać o dostosowaniu interfejsu do standardów Androida oraz optymalizacji kodu dla lepszej wydajności aplikacji.
Szybkie i efektywne sposoby na optymalizację kodu w aplikacjach mobilnych z wykorzystaniem HTML, CSS i JavaScript dla urządzeń z systemem Android
Optymalizacja kodu jest kluczowym elementem w tworzeniu aplikacji mobilnych dla urządzeń z systemem Android. Dzięki temu można poprawić wydajność i szybkość działania aplikacji, co przekłada się na lepsze doświadczenie użytkownika. Istnieje wiele szybkich i efektywnych sposobów na optymalizację kodu w aplikacjach mobilnych, które wykorzystują HTML, CSS i JavaScript.
1. Minimalizacja plików CSS i JavaScript – im mniej plików, tym szybsze ładowanie strony. Warto więc połączyć wszystkie pliki CSS w jeden oraz wszystkie pliki JavaScript w jeden.
2. Wykorzystanie kompresji – dzięki kompresji plików CSS i JavaScript można zmniejszyć ich rozmiar, co przyspieszy ładowanie strony.
3. Unikanie nadmiernego użycia obrazków – duże obrazki mogą spowolnić działanie aplikacji mobilnej. Warto więc używać tylko niezbędnych grafik o odpowiednich rozmiarach.
4. Optymalizacja obrazków – przed dodaniem obrazka do aplikacji warto zoptymalizować jego rozmiar i format, np. używając narzędzi online lub specjalnych programów.
5. Używanie pływających elementów zamiast absolutnego pozycjonowania – pływające elementy są bardziej responsywne i nie wymagają ustalania dokładnej pozycji na stronie.
6. Unikanie animacji CSS3 – animacje CSS3 mogą być piękne, ale mogą również spowolnić działanie aplikacji. Warto więc ograniczyć ich użycie lub zastąpić je prostszymi animacjami.
7. Używanie lokalnych zasobów – jeśli aplikacja korzysta z wielu zewnętrznych zasobów, warto przechowywać je lokalnie, co przyspieszy ich ładowanie.
8. Testowanie na różnych urządzeniach – przed wypuszczeniem aplikacji warto przetestować ją na różnych urządzeniach, aby upewnić się, że działa ona sprawnie i szybko na każdym z nich.
Optymalizacja kodu jest niezbędnym krokiem w tworzeniu wydajnych i szybkich aplikacji mobilnych dla urządzeń z systemem Android. Dzięki wykorzystaniu powyższych sposobów można poprawić działanie aplikacji i zapewnić użytkownikom pozytywne doświadczenie.
Android app z wykorzystaniem HTML, CSS i JavaScript jest bardzo popularnym rozwiązaniem w dzisiejszych czasach. Dzięki temu połączeniu możliwe jest tworzenie aplikacji mobilnych, które są nie tylko funkcjonalne, ale także estetyczne i responsywne.
Wykorzystanie tych technologii pozwala na łatwe dostosowanie aplikacji do różnych rozmiarów ekranów oraz systemów operacyjnych. Ponadto, dzięki wykorzystaniu języka JavaScript możliwe jest tworzenie interaktywnych elementów w aplikacji, co zwiększa jej atrakcyjność dla użytkowników.
Warto również wspomnieć o korzyściach dla programistów. Tworzenie aplikacji z wykorzystaniem HTML, CSS i JavaScript jest prostsze i szybsze niż przy użyciu innych języków programowania. Ponadto, istnieje wiele narzędzi i frameworków wspierających rozwój tego typu aplikacji.
Podsumowując, android app z wykorzystaniem HTML, CSS i JavaScript to świetne rozwiązanie dla twórców aplikacji mobilnych. Dzięki temu połączeniu możliwe jest stworzenie funkcjonalnej, estetycznej i responsywnej aplikacji w krótkim czasie. Jest to również korzystne dla programistów ze względu na prostotę i szybkość tworzenia oraz dostępność narzędzi wspierających ten proces.